在这个语句中,timestamp_column是你要转换的timestamp列名,table_name是你的表名。这条SQL语句会返回一个包含Unix时间戳(即int类型)的结果集。 测试转换结果,确保其准确性: 在实际应用中,你应该执行上述SQL语句并检查返回的结果,以确保转换的准确性。 对转换后的int值进行验证或进一步处理: 根据你的具体需求,...
步骤2:将Unix时间戳转换为int类型 在MySQL中,我们可以使用CAST()函数或者直接在应用程序中进行类型转换来将Unix时间戳转换为int类型。 使用CAST()函数 SELECTCAST(UNIX_TIMESTAMP(timestamp_column)ASSIGNED)ASint_timestampFROMtable_name; 1. 上面的代码中,timestamp_column是你的timestamp列名,table_name是你的表...
created_at列的数据类型是DATETIME,用来存储用户的创建时间。我们插入了三条示例数据,并使用UNIX_TIMESTAMP函数将created_at的时间转换为整型,并将结果作为created_at_int返回。 结论 通过使用UNIX_TIMESTAMP函数,我们可以将MySQL中的时间数据转换为整型数据,以便进行计算或比较操作。在实际开发中,这种转换常常用于数据分析...
MySQL中的时间类型主要包括DATETIME、TIMESTAMP等,而INT类型是一种整数类型。将时间转换为INT类型通常是为了便于存储、传输或进行某些特定的计算。 转换方法 MySQL提供了多种函数来将时间转换为INT类型,最常用的是UNIX_TIMESTAMP()函数。这个函数可以将一个DATETIME或TIMESTAMP值转换为从1970年1月1日00:00:00 UTC到指...
MySQL中的时间类型主要包括DATETIME、TIMESTAMP等,而INT类型是一种整数类型。将时间转换为INT类型通常是为了便于存储、传输或进行某些特定的计算。 转换方法 MySQL提供了多种函数来将时间转换为INT类型,最常用的是UNIX_TIMESTAMP()函数。这个函数可以将一个DATETIME或TIMESTAMP值转换为从1970年1月1日00:00:00 UTC到指...
1、在存储时间戳数据时,先将本地时区时间转换为UTC时区时间,再将UTC时区时间转换为INT格式的毫秒值(使用UNIX_TIMESTAMP函数),然后存放到数据库中。 2、在读取时间戳数据时,先将INT格式的毫秒值转换为UTC时区时间(使用FROM_UNIXTIME函数),然后再转换为本地时区时间,最后返回给客户端。
mysql中一个表的一个时间列是int类型,现在想修改这个字段的值,打算可读日期时间格式转成int,然后修改那个值。 这个转换函数就是UNIX_TIMESTAMP,将可读的时间转换成int类型,具体用法: update xxx_table set xxx_time=UNIX_TIMESTAMP('2006-11-13 13:24:22') where ... 同时介绍...
SELECTUNIX_TIMESTAMP(timestamp_field)*1000ASint_timestampFROMyour_table; 1. 2. 在这个示例中,timestamp_field是你要转换的timestamp字段的名称,your_table是你要查询的表名。这条SQL语句将会查询出将timestamp字段转换成13位int类型后的值。 实际应用 ...
转载: https://www.cnblogs.com/longzhongren/p/4596278.html函数:FROM_UNIXTIME作用:将MYSQL中以INT(11)存储的时间以"YYYY-MM-DD"格式来显示。 语法:FROM_UNIXTIME(unix_timestamp,format) 返回表示 …